I2C总线有三种数据传输速度:标准的是100Kbps,快速模式为400Kbps,高速模式为3.4Mbps。发送到SDA 线上的每个字节必须为8 位,每次传输可以发送的字节数量不受限制。每个字节后必须跟一个响应位。首先传输的是数据的最高位(MSB)。
I2C的包起始信息- SCL为高时,SDA发生从高到低的翻转
I2C的停止状态– SCL为高时,SDA发生从低到高的翻转
第9个比特是Master 发出的ACK(响应),要求传输中主机接收器必须通过在从机发出的最后一个字节时产生一个响应,向从机发送器通知数据结束。
通过示波器可对I2C总线信号进行观测并解码查看返回高度信息。
超声波定位信息通信解码
光流定位信息通信解码
RS232总线